Ohio's demand runs down one spine - the 3-C corridor linking Columbus, Cleveland and Cincinnati along I-71, with Toledo anchoring the northwest. Columbus is the state capital and its largest city, yet each metro is its own local-search market with its own competitors. Distance is a real Google ranking factor, so you rank strongest near your address and fade as you move out - a contractor in Dublin can own the map there and disappear across Columbus. A single check from the office shows one flattering point and hides the rest, so we map the whole area with a geo-grid instead.

The climate quietly sets the trade calendar here. Ohio's freeze-thaw winters - water seeping into cracks, freezing, then expanding - are hard on roofs, driveways and foundations, which keeps roofers, masons and foundation crews in steady demand. Snowy stretches, heaviest in the Lake Erie snowbelt around Cleveland, spike heating and burst-pipe calls for HVAC techs and plumbers. When those surges hit, the businesses already sitting in the top three of the map pack take the calls before anyone else gets a look.

The upside is that many Ohio markets are steady and less saturated than the coasts, so a properly optimized profile can stand out faster here than in a crowded Sun Belt metro. Why do I rank in one Ohio suburb but not the next one over?
Because distance is a genuine ranking factor. You appear strongest near your registered address and weaker farther away, so a shop in Westerville can dominate nearby and fade across Columbus. A geo-grid shows your real coverage suburb by suburb, telling us precisely where to reinforce citations, reviews or service-area settings.
Does Ohio's freeze-thaw weather affect my SEO strategy?
Indirectly, but it matters. Ohio's freeze-thaw cycles drive steady demand for roofing, masonry, foundation and gutter work, and searches for those jobs surge with the seasons. Because rankings take time to build, we prepare your profile and reviews ahead of each spike so you are visible when homeowners start searching, not scrambling after.
Can a service-area business rank in Ohio without a storefront?
Yes. Plumbers, HVAC companies and roofers rank as service-area businesses by defining their coverage in Google Business Profile instead of listing a storefront address. Your base location still feeds the distance factor, so where you operate from within a metro like Cleveland shapes which suburbs you can realistically rank in.
